How Does a Cavitation Machine Work?
Cavitation machines use ultrasound waves to create a treatment called cavitation. The waves produce small bubbles within fat cells that increase in size and burst. They disintegrate fat cells into liquid that your body will naturally release. It's a non-invasive treatment to reduce fat and contour your body (body sculpting).
What Does 30K, 40K, and 80K Cavitation Mean?
The 30K, 40K, and 80K represent the frequency of the ultrasound waves utilized in the machine. The frequencies indicate how deeply your skin will be penetrated by the waves and how efficiently they will break down your fat cells.
Low frequency (e.g., 30K) penetrates deeper into fat layers and high frequency (e.g., 80K) penetrates shallow layers. This is due to the inverse relationship of frequency to wavelength: higher frequency implies shorter wavelength and therefore shallower penetration.

Difference Between 30K, 40K, and 80K Cavitation Machines
This section will explore 6 key differences between the three frequencies to help you understand their unique features and applications.
1. Frequency Defines Skin Depth
The frequency of the ultrasound waves determines how deeply they penetrate the skin and fat layers. Here’s how each frequency performs:
Frequency | Penetration Depth | Main Use |
30K | 12.5 mm | Deep fat layers, cellulite reduction |
40K | 9.4 mm | Moderate fat layers, overall contouring |
80K | 4.7 mm | Shallow fat layers, fine-tuning |
- 30K: Best for breaking down thick fat deposits and reducing cellulite.
- 40K: Ideal for moderate fat reduction and overall body contouring.
- 80K: Perfect for shallow fat layers and skin tightening.

3. Noise Level
- 30K and 40K: Produce louder noises due to lower frequencies and stronger vibrations.
- 80K: Operates more quietly, making it more comfortable for users.
4. Thermal Effect
- 30K and 40K: Generate lower temperatures (30-40°C), which are safer for longer treatments.
- 80K: Produces higher temperatures (40-50°C), enhancing fat reduction but requiring careful monitoring to avoid burns.
5. Differences in Operation
- 80K: Requires additional precautions due to higher heat output. Users should control treatment duration and follow post-care instructions strictly.
- 30K and 40K: Easier to operate with fewer risks of overheating.
